Workforce Needs in Massachusetts' Biotech Industry
Massachusetts is recognized as a hub for biotechnology, boasting over 1,000 biotech firms and employing more than 70,000 workers. However, the rapid pace of innovation within the biotech industry reveals a concerning skills gap, particularly in advanced data analytics. The Massachusetts Biotechnology Council has highlighted that many professionals lack the necessary training in data-driven research methodologies essential for enhancing research efficiency and accelerating project timelines.
This skills gap poses a barrier for both new graduates entering the workforce and existing professionals seeking to advance their careers within the biotech sector. As the industry continues to evolve with the integration of artificial intelligence and machine learning techniques, the demand for a workforce with advanced data analytics capabilities is growing dramatically. Existing training programs need to be redesigned to meet these aggressive industry standards.
To address these workforce needs, funding for advanced analytics training for biotech professionals is critical. This initiative will focus on providing targeted training programs that equip workers with the data skills necessary to thrive in a competitive market. The curriculum will emphasize practical applications of data analytics in drug development and research settings, aligning academic learning with industry demands.
Implementation will require collaboration between biotechnology firms, academic institutions, and industry associations to ensure training is directly applicable to the unique challenges faced by the sector. Success will be evaluated by improved research efficiency, accelerated project timelines, and increased innovation outputs from trained professionals. By fostering a data-literate workforce, Massachusetts can solidify its position as a leader in biotechnology and continue to drive advancements in health and medicine.
